Coordinate all aspects of facility goals and objectives in Environment, Health and Safety (EHS).
Will report to the General Manager, Operations Manager or Manufacturing Manager depending upon division size and structure, and work with their staff on a regular basis. In matters of EHS, will be directly responsible for successful implementation of EHS programs and procedures.

- BS Degree in a technical field, preferably EHS (extensive experience with certificate programs, seminars and CEU's or associates degree possibly acceptable).
- A strong working knowledge of EHS regulations.
- Experience in a manufacturing environment a must.
- Experience in Ergonomics and Behavior Based Safety a plus.
- 3+ years of applicable experience
- Can work independently.
- Excellent communication and computer skills.
- Creative ability in insuring safety of employees, the environment while meeting the needs of production.
- Ability to plan and implement EHS programs.
- Strong presentation skills.
- Ability to work effectively with management as well as with associates from the floor.
- Must be able to travel and work out of the office.
